With the gradual development of the Reform and Opening Up and theestablishment of the market economy system, Chinese economic development hasmade remarkable achievements in the world. The Process of Modernization, theReform and Opening Up and the market economy are developing constantly, and oursociety begins to appear a deep population differentiation, which has unavoidablyaffected the contemporary youth, especially the college students. The contemporarycollege students are the masters of Chinese future society, the reserve forces to build asocialist harmonious society, and the people who will make Chinese dream come true.Harmonious college campus requires the various groups of college students interactpositively and develop healthily. The fundamental purpose of education is to cultivatepeople, and the colleges and universities need to cultivate qualified builders andreliable successors for the socialist development. As for this purpose, they cannot justfocus their attention on the intellectual education and ignore the moral education, andmust seize the moral education which is the heart and soul of the quality collegeeducation. Although the current moral research involves the group differentiation, itpays more attention to the disadvantaged groups of the various students’ groups. Interms of other students’ groups, it pays little attention and seldom studies them as anorganic entity. Obviously, this is a relative weak chain in the college moral education.Based on the basic principles of Marxism, and guided by the educationalphilosophy of Mao Zedong Thought, Deng Xiaoping Theory,“Three Represents” andScientific Outlook on development, and combined with the relative knowledge of theIdeological and Political Education, sociology and psychology, and using theperspective of crossover study to select the group differentiation as a breakthroughpoint, and using the literature research method and information research method, thispaper analyzes and organizes relative materials, and clarifies the concept of collegestudents’ differentiation. Besides, combined with the interviews and questionnaires,this paper also investigates the current situation and influence of the college students’group differentiation. Among the institutions of higher education, college students’ group differentiation shows a gradual development trend. From the point of horizontaldifferentiation, college students’ differentiation shows distinctive groups; from theperspective of vertical differentiation, college students’ groups present differentstructures at different stages. On one hand, the influence of the group differentiationfor college students mainly manifests the positive influence for college individuals,interpersonal relations, and college tolerance; on the other hand, it shows passiveinfluence for the advantaged and disadvantaged groups and their relations.Through comprehensive analysis, this paper points out that from the perspectiveof group differentiation, the major problems of the college students’ moral educationare: college students’ values are eroded by the unhealthy social trends; the existingmoral teaching has limited influence on college students; comparatively there is a lackof moral activities in extracurricular activities; some college students has not paidsufficient attention to moral education. To sum up, there are four major reasons: First,society is the big environment for moral education, and the various passive influenceof social group differentiation is flooded in the college; there are a variety of values inthe contemporary life, which brings a problem for college moral education. Second,family is the harbor for students, and the family backgrounds and parents’ thinkingpatterns exert a subtle influence on students; if the students are instilled with improperideas, which will lead to the ignorance and confrontation for students’ moraleducation. Moreover, as the main position for students’ moral education, if collegesdo not pay attention to the targeted teaching of the moral education of various groups,and the variety of moral activities of extracurricular activities, the influence of moraleducation will be greatly weakened. And finally, the intellectual education determinesthe level of development, while the moral education determines the direction ofdevelopment. However, lots of students have a poor knowledge of moral educationand ignore the cultivation of moral quality, which puts the moral education in anawkward position.This paper indicates that: through rich campus activities to promote the exchangeand integration among groups, to guide the students’ self-confidence, independence,and self-reliance, and to believe the beneficial conversion between student groups, thus colleges can strengthen the positive impact of group differentiation for collegestudents. Colleges should purify the social environment, create a positive harmoniousatmosphere, pay attention to home education, guide students to find their properlocation, and restrain the passive influence of the vertical differentiation for collegestudents. In the end, colleges should strengthen the university management. Andthrough research, they can learn about all the students’ groups, be individualized, payattention to distinctive education, and carry out the targeted moral education for groupwork to promote healthy development and the beneficial transformation andintegration of various groups, to promote the harmonious campus construction, and topromote the realization of a harmonious society.
